How Our Contaminated Water Removal Process Works
Our process is designed to reduce disruption to your daily life while ensuring the water is removed safely and efficiently. We’ll start by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. Next, we’ll use our specialized equipment to extract the water and dry out your property. Finally, we’ll cl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ent mold and bacteria growth. You can trust our team to handle every step of the process, from start to finish.
Assessment and Leak Detection
We’ll use our equipment to detect the source of the leak and assess the damage. This will help us find out the best course of action for the cleanup process.
Water Extraction
We’ll use our specialized equipment to extract every last drop of water from your property. This will help pr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and bacteria growth.
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use our equipment to dry out your property and remove any excess moisture. This will help prevent mold and bacteria growth and reduce the risk of further damage.
Cleaning and Disinfection
We’ll cl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ent mold and bacteria growth. This will help ensure your property is safe and healthy for you and your family.

Contaminated Water Removal Cost In Booneville, MS
The cost of contaminated water removal can vary depending on the severity of the problem and the size of the affected area. But, here are some estimated price ranges for different services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Leak Detection |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the problem. |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water involved and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of equipment needed. |
| Cleaning and Disinfection |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ning and disinfection required. |
| Restoration and Repair | $1,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of repairs needed. |
| Dehumidification and Ventilation |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
Keep in mind that these are just estimates, and the actual cost of contaminated water removal will depend on the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ates and will work with you to find out the best course of action and the associated costs.

Common Questions About Contaminated Water Removal
How long does contaminated water removal take?
The length of time it takes to complete contaminated water removal depends on the severity of the problem and the amount of water involved. In general, it can take anywhere from a few hours to several days to complete the process.
Is contaminated water removal covered by insurance?
Yes, contaminated water removal is usually covered by insurance if it’s caused by a sudden and accidental event, such as a burst pipe or a flood. But, the exact coverage and terms will depend on your individual policy.
Is contaminated water removal safe?
Yes, contaminated water removal is safe when performed by a professional with the right equipment and expertise. But, it’s essential to take precautions to avoid exposure to mold and bacteria.
How do I prevent contaminated water?
You can prevent contaminated water by fixing leaks quickly, checking for signs of water damage regularly, and using a dehumidifier to reduce moisture levels.
How do I clean and disinfect after contaminated water removal?
You can clean and disinfect after contaminated water removal by using a solution of bleach and water to kill bacteria and mold. It’s essential to wear protective gear, including gloves and a mask, to avoid exposure.
